This article is about the EV-raising items introduced in Generation V. For Rainbow and Silver Wings, see Silver and Rainbow Wings. For the item related to Cresselia, see Lunar Wing. For the character in Throwing in the Noctowl, see Wings Alexander.

A wing (Japanese: ハネ feather) is a type of item from the Pokémon games. They are used to boost the stats of a Trainer's Pokémon. Although they are feathers, they are called wings in English-language games, due to character limitations.

Effect

The first six wings can be considered a less powerful version of vitamins. Unlike vitamins, however, they are not subject to the 100 EV cap. Like vitamins, they are consumed after use. Each one gives a Pokémon one effort value (EV) in a particular stat.

There is a seventh wing, the Pretty Wing, which is similar in appearance and can be found in the same locations as the others; however, it serves no purpose other than to be sold.

Acquisition

In Generation V, Wings can be found in Flying Pokémon's shadows on the Driftveil Drawbridge and Marvelous Bridge, or as rewards for earning low ranks in the Battle Institute or clearing areas in Black Tower/White Treehollow.

In Generation VI, they are obtainable from Super Secret Training regimens in Super Training.

In Generation VII, certain Pokémon found in ambush encounters can occasionally drop Wings when defeated.

Some NPCs will give out Health or Swift Wings to players with a Pokémon with sufficiently high Speed or Attack, respectively.

In the anime

Wings in the anime

In Reunion Battles In Nimbasa!, a full set of wings was announced to be the prize for winning the Club Battle tournament. In Club Battle Finale: A Hero's Outcome!, the set of wings was won by Iris, who later sent them to the Village of Dragons.

In the manga

In the Pokémon Adventures manga

In Mr. Perfect, Magician gave Blake a pack of wings he had requested from him. In Innocent Scientist, Blake revealed that he had given a Resist Wing and Rare Candy to his Dewott just before heading to battle Genesect, boosting its defenses just enough for it to be able to survive an Electric-type Techno Blast.
